27/06/2014, 02:27
|
| | | Fecha de Ingreso: enero-2008 Ubicación: Donostia - San Sebastián
Mensajes: 756
Antigüedad: 16 años, 11 meses Puntos: 32 | |
Respuesta: en java se puede meter un objeto dentro de otro, esto se puede en php? En PHP también se usa esta práctica. Cuando "metes" un objeto dentro de otro no lo estás metiendo, realmente estas metiendo una referencia a ese objeto.
El objetivo de meter objetos dentro de otros es utilizar la funcionalidad de un objeto en otro. Imagínate que tienes una clase que registra logs y otra que manda mails. Y quieres que cada vez que se manda un mail, éste quede registrado en un log. Lo lógico entonces es "meter" un objeto de la clase de log dentro del objeto de de la clase mail para que cuando ésta envíe un mail utilice el objeto log "metido" para registrar ese log.
No se si queda claro. |